Hi My Name is David and I am a brain tumor survivor. I have had 2 brain tumor surgerys and I go every 6 months to have MRI's done to monitor the mass that I have now. After my most recent scan my results came back showing a slight increase but fortunately it isn't causing any problems with my ventricles. So until the next MRI in January things are stable. It's hard being a kid with brain tumors, they have to shave your head, Now I can't get my hair buzz cut, because you'll see my scars. After my second tumor surgery I had a stroke which caused me to lose part of my vision. I don't have any peripheral vision. It's like looking through a straw.
